    Passenger Plane Struck by Firework During Chicago Landing, No Injuries

    A commercial aircraft carrying 52 passengers and six crew members was struck by a firework as it was making its landing approach in Chicago. Despite the unexpected incident, the plane landed safely without any reported injuries among those onboard. The event caused concern among passengers but did not result in any immediate danger or damage affecting the flight’s completion.

    Fireworks near airports pose significant safety risks, as they can distract pilots or potentially damage aircraft during critical phases of flight such as landing or takeoff. This incident highlights the need for stricter enforcement of regulations prohibiting fireworks in the vicinity of airports to ensure the safety of air travel. Aviation authorities typically monitor and investigate such occurrences to prevent future hazards.

    In a significant development for aviation safety, this event serves as a reminder of the vulnerabilities aircraft face from external factors during flight operations. While no injuries occurred this time, the potential consequences could be severe, underscoring the importance of public awareness and compliance with safety rules around airports. Authorities are likely to review security measures to mitigate risks posed by unauthorized fireworks near flight paths.
